Free Guy emerged as one of the biggest surprises of the summer movie season, blending sharp video game satire with Ryan Reynolds charisma. The film follows a bank teller who discovers he is a background non-player character in a massively multiplayer online game, turning his ordinary day into an extraordinary quest for selfhood.
As a popcorn action comedy with a meta spin on artificial life and creative control, Free Guy resonates with gamers and mainstream audiences alike. This overview outlines why the movie became a cultural talking point and how its themes echo beyond the multiplex.

Ryan Reynolds Performance And Character Arc
Playing A Background Character
Reynods brings a layer of meta charm to Guy, subverting the typical action hero by starting as an NPC who gains awareness. His performance balances slapstick humor with moments of genuine introspection.
Chemistry With The Supporting Cast
The movie leverages Reynolds quick wit in scenes with co-stars like Jodie Comer and Lil Rel Howery, making the ensemble dynamic feel both competitive and collaborative.

Is Free Guy suitable for a family movie night?
Yes, the film is rated PG-13 and balances action with humor that works for teens and adults, though younger children may miss some of the video game references.
How does Ryan Reynolds role differ from his Deadpool character?
Unlike the talkative anti hero Wade Wilson, Guy starts as a mostly innocent NPC, letting Reynolds explore a more reactive, wide eyed performance while still delivering witty lines.
